A new report has surfaced suggesting that Microsoft is pumped up and ready to give the world a little taste of their new-generation computer operating system that will succeed Windows 8.
The even is currently being planned for the 30 September at which they will showcase the OS called ‘Windows 9’. Microsoft is expected to release a developer preview as early as October before releasing a public preview by the end of the year.
Some of the features of Windows 9 OS that have leaked in these past few months:
- Ubuntu-style virtual desktop feature for users to stay organised and use their apps on multiple virtual desktops within a single PC system (with or without multiple monitor screens).
- Removal of the Charms Bar, which debuted on Windows 8
- Two-column Start menu that combines Modern apps and desktop apps. The update is also expected to bring the ability to run Modern Windows apps in windowed mode, which could tie in with the virtual desktops feature as well.
While a public preview may be released before the end of the year, the general public release is only expected in April 2015.
